The company sells its software worldwide to corporations, educational institutions, government agencies, and small businesses. TechSmith sells SnagIt, Camtasia Studio and Morae applications and hosts screencast.com, a screencast hosting service. As a privately-held company with no recent venture funding, TechSmith maintains a profitable, bootstrap-driven model with a focus on its established product portfolio and training/education market expansion.

Recent Developments
(May 2025) Formation of Training Advisory Board to expand enterprise learning and digital training offerings
(December 2025) Launch of Camtasia Online for real-time video editing without desktop downloads
(Early 2026) Continued product enhancements focused on AI-assisted editing, text-based video editing, and removal of filler words/hesitations from training videos
